Unknown Location

“Cheers gentlemen. Now let us unleash him onto the net. Our perfect soldier shall do what our previous soldiers could not.”

Location: Outside the stadium

Django breathed heavily, exhausted.

“impossibile…..”

But he could not stop. He ran as fast as he could, the blasts from Shade Man’s attacks becoming ever more accurate.

But then something happened.

The blasts stopped. Django dared to look behind him.

Shade Man wasn’t moving. He stood still, though Django thought it looked as if Shade Man was struggling to move, as if some force restricted him.

“We thank you, Solar Boy. Your service has been most appreciated in awakening the Dark Soul.” A voice said from seemingly nowhere.

“che cosa significate?”

“Mr. Solar Boy, if you must speak, speak in a language we can understand.” The voice answered.

Django breathed in deeply. “What do you mean?”

“Simple. We brought you here for the sole purpose of activating the Dark Soul.”

“Why?”

“You see that the dark soul refuses to fade?”

Django nodded, staring at Shade Man, who continued to struggle.

“You have us to thank for that."

“What!?” Django yelled.

“Actually, you have Nebula to thank for that. We merely continued the project they so foolishly discontinued.

Django searched his memory. He remembered hearing Nebula from somewhere, but he couldn’t quite put his finger on it.

“And thanks to you, we will be able to unleash our perfect soldier onto the net. For that we thank you.”

“I can still destroy him”

“Very well than, we shall see how well you do. Farewell, Solar Boy.”

With that, a portal appeared. Shade Man stepped into it, though whether or not it was of his own accord was could not be seen.

Django swallowed, with an audible gulp and muttered one thing before he rushed into the portal.

“Maggio il sole lo protegge”
